> V4L2 Video devices should always start streaming from index zero.
> Identify and report a warning if they don't, and correct for any offset.
[1] sequence
"The count starts at zero and includes dropped or repeated frames"
So if the sensor driver has set a value via subdev sensor ops
g_skip_frames[2], shouldn't it include that count? Or is skipping
considered different from dropping?
(I probably ought to add support for g_skip_frames to the Unicam
driver at some point).

> I'm not yet sure if the Warning print is perhaps just unhelpful.
> It doesn't really affect us if we have this work around in - so we can
> be silent, and I'm not yet sure if V4L2 has any 'requirement' that it
> should start at 0 at every stream on.
